1982 Benson & Hedges Cup

The 1982 Benson & Hedges Cup was the eleventh competing of cricket’s Benson & Hedges Cup.

1982 Benson & Hedges Cup
Administrator(s)Test and County Cricket Board
Cricket formatLimited overs cricket
(55 overs per innings)
ChampionsSomerset (1st title)
Participants20
Matches played47
Most runs317 Neil Taylor (Kent)
Most wickets19 Colin Croft (Lancashire)

The competition was won by Somerset County Cricket Club.
